Verification Engineer

Job Description

We are looking for a verification design engineer with experience of complex digital design projects. The successful candidate must have a pragmatic approach to problem solving with a broad range of technical skills, a passion for learning and the motivation to push for progress both individually and collectively. As a small team, verification is tightly integrated to all aspects of the design process providing an exciting opportunity to learn and contribute in all areas of the creative process from architecture, software, implementation and infrastructure. The role will involve working closely with trading teams providing a unique opportunity to learn a new and fast moving market sector.

What You’ll Do:

  • Work within a small multi-disciplinary hardware design team to ensure the success of leading-edge ASIC/SoC developments.
  • Contribute to the continued development of the design productivity tooling and workflows.
  • Stay informed of the latest developments in design and verification techniques.
  • Develop creative solutions balancing effort, risk and innovation to meet the challenge of right-first-time design projects.
  • Interpret high level requirements to create exceptional solutions for the trading community.
  • Other duties as assigned or needed

Skills You’ll Need:

  • Sound understanding of technology trade-offs, and a pragmatic approach to problem solving.
  • Experience in the following:
    • Writing and implementing verification plans.
    • Architecting and implementing verification environments using leading-edge industry techniques.
    • Metric-driven sign-off
    • Regression automation and continuous integration design process.
  • Strong software/HDL development skills – SystemVerilog, Python, C/C++.
  • Complex debugging skills in both hardware and software environments.
  • Able to work collaboratively with the wider ASIC design team to facilitate rapid project convergence and execution.
  • Degree in Electrical and Electronic Engineering, computer science, mathematics, physics or related subject.
  • At least 3+ years of verification design experience.
  • Reliable and predictable availability

Bonus Points:

  • Experience of industry methodologies - UVM, SVA, UPF.
  • Experience of formal proof technologies.
  • Experience developing development infrastructure - shell, HTML, MySQL.
  • Experience of embedded software – assembly language, processor architecture.